#87563f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#87563f is composed of 52.9% red, 33.7%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.3% magenta, 53.3%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 19.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 38.8%. #87563f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ffac7e with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#87563f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#87563f has RGB values of R:135, G:86,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.53,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8869439.

Hex triplet 87563f #87563f
RGB Decimal 135, 86, 63 rgb(135,86,63)
RGB Percent 52.9, 33.7, 24.7 rgb(52.9%,33.7%,24.7%)
CMYK 0, 36, 53, 47
HSL 19.2°, 36.4, 38.8 hsl(19.2,36.4%,38.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 19.2°, 53.3, 52.9
Web Safe 996633 #996633
CIE-LAB 41.479, 17.66, 21.739
XYZ 14.217, 12.166, 6.302
xyY 0.435, 0.372, 12.166
CIE-LCH 41.479, 28.008, 50.911
CIE-LUV 41.479, 35.537, 21.296
Hunter-Lab 34.88, 11.715, 13.704
Binary 10000111, 01010110, 00111111
